The Naturals Composition DSP (sadly, retiring) is perfect to use with gesso as it resists it and you get this awesome look with little effort! I finally ordered the Spiral Flower die and I LOVE it! You can't really mail this card easily, but it's perfect to add in a gift bag with a gift!

I thought I'd share a card we are making at my techniques class later this month. It's a new technique to me called acrylic batik and this was my first attempt. I think I need a bit more practice, but I like it! I left the card pretty simple since the focus is more on learning the technique.
